Leaflet layer to WKT

function toWKT(layer) { | |
var lng, lat, coords = []; | |
if (layer instanceof L.Polygon || layer instanceof L.Polyline) { | |
var latlngs = layer.getLatLngs(); | |
for (var i = 0; i < latlngs.length; i++) { | |
latlngs[i] | |
coords.push(latlngs[i].lng + " " + latlngs[i].lat); | |
if (i === 0) { | |
lng = latlngs[i].lng; | |
lat = latlngs[i].lat; | |
} | |
}; | |
if (layer instanceof L.Polygon) { | |
return "POLYGON((" + coords.join(",") + "," + lng + " " + lat + "))"; | |
} else if (layer instanceof L.Polyline) { | |
return "LINESTRING(" + coords.join(",") + ")"; | |
} | |
} else if (layer instanceof L.Marker) { | |
return "POINT(" + layer.getLatLng().lng + " " + layer.getLatLng().lat + ")"; | |
} | |
} |
